I was thinking about this today....

It appears there are (granted, it's still warm and I could be wrong here) but seems to be a 30% of normal coyote crop.  I keep asking the question why.  Most of the dogs I've killed this fall have been adults with only SWAG killing the pups :chuckle:  But....no question the pheasants took a beating this spring, time after time with every hatch getting followed up by a big rain storm.  I didn't (previously) think that there very much of the coyotes diet would be chicks or game birds but this has me thinking..... :dunno:

I've read some comments on here about some guys who also feel the numbers are down and am just curious.  Most of the dogs I've killed have been a bit pink in the crotch as well.... :dunno:

Thoughts?
